The Visual Language of LogicMovie buffs possess a highly trained eye for visual storytelling. They do not just watch a film; they analyze the frame, the lighting, and the background elements. When designing science fiction for this discerning audience, the first rule is to establish a rigorous visual logic. Every spaceship design, futuristic gadget, and alien landscape must look like it functions for a specific purpose rather than just looking cool. Audiences instantly spot arbitrary flashing lights or meaningless tubes attached to armor. To satisfy film enthusiasts, a designer must ground the extraordinary in the familiar. This means researching real-world engineering, industrial design, and architecture to create a tangible evolution of technology that feels completely believable.
Texture, Grit, and the Lived-In UniverseCinematic history shifted permanently when the concept of the lived-in universe was introduced. Film buffs deeply appreciate texture and the physical history of a setting. Pristine, perfectly clean white corridors can work for specific utopian narratives, but a world with grit, grease, and wear often carries more narrative weight. Designing for film enthusiasts requires thinking about how objects age in the future. Dirt in the corners of a starship cockpit, scratched paint on a robot chassis, and mismatched repair parts tell a story without a single line of dialogue. These details signal to the audience that the world existed long before the cameras started rolling and will continue to exist after the credits roll.
The Power of Subversive TechnologyExperienced film viewers are intimately familiar with standard science fiction tropes. They know what a teleportation device, a laser rifle, or a time machine usually looks like. To truly engage them, a designer must subvert these expectations while maintaining functional clarity. Instead of a sleek handheld device, perhaps a piece of advanced technology is bulky, hazardous to use, or requires an immense power source that anchors it to a specific room. Modifying how characters interact with technology creates friction, and friction creates compelling cinema. When tools are temperamental or carry heavy consequences, the stakes of the narrative rise naturally, rewarding the audience for paying close attention to the mechanics of the world.
Inhabitable and Cultural ArchitectureScience fiction design extends far beyond gadgets and vehicles; it encompasses entire societies. Movie buffs analyze how environments reflect the culture, politics, and history of the people who inhabit them. A mega-city controlled by corporations should look distinctly different from a frontier outpost on a desert moon. Designers must consider the stratification of society within the architecture itself. Towering spires of glass might look down upon dark, neon-soaked alleyways, visually representing economic disparity. Incorporating layers of historical graffiti, archaic advertising, and evolving fashion trends into the background scenery gives the film enthusiast a rich tapestry to decode during multiple viewings.
Embracing Practical Realism in the Digital AgeWhile digital tools offer limitless creative freedom, the most revered science fiction films often blend physical craftsmanship with computer-generated imagery. Movie buffs have a keen sense for weight, scale, and the way light interacts with real surfaces. Whenever possible, designing physical props, partial sets, and practical animatronics enhances the reality of the performance and the frame. Even when a shot requires heavy digital enhancement, basing the core designs on physical miniatures or real-world locations provides an irreplaceable sense of gravity. This tactile approach bridges the gap between fantasy and reality, ensuring the audience remains fully immersed in the cinematic experience.
Crafting Atmospheric DepthThe ultimate goal of designing science fiction for cinema lovers is to build an environment that functions as a silent character. Through the deliberate use of color palettes, shadow, scale, and texture, a designer can evoke specific emotional responses that align with the narrative theme. High-contrast lighting can make a research facility feel claustrophobic and paranoid, while vast, minimalist landscapes can amplify a sense of cosmic isolation. By treating every frame as an intricate puzzle of visual information, creators can deliver a rich, uncompromising world that stands up to the intense scrutiny of dedicated movie buffs.
